Can you put an SFX PSU into an ATX case
bjfaia5
Sep 20, 2012, 7:35 PM
Like the title says can you put an SFX PSU into an ATX case? Will t fit and will the mounting screws line up?

No an SFX PSU does not natively mount in a case designed for an ATX PSU. Some SFX PSUs come with an adapter bracket which will allow this to happen.
